naconst....... it all depends on where you live and the time of the year. my moltri goes for weeks in warm weather. but right now it is 20 degrees here and any camera battery out there is only going to last a week if you are lucky. in this weather if the battery is not even in a camera it is going to be dead in just over a week and even quicker if it is operating in a camera outside.get yourself a rechargeable or two. you need it in the colder temps.
